Hi,

Please find attached patch file which contains function/procedure debug
support under package node. (RM #1577)

Do review it and let me know for any comments.

Thanks, applied. Couple of questions/points:

- If there is no body for a procedure, the error is handled somewhat
ungracefully - the message is displayed without line breaks, and the
debugger panel is left empty. Can we make that a little nicer?

- In pgAdmin 3 there's a "Debug package initialiser?" option on the
parameter dialogue. Is that shown for appropriate packages? I don't
have an example to hand to test with.
